3. Bradley is an engineer and has two college-age children, Clint, a freshman at State University, and Abigail, a junior at Northwest University. Both Clint and Abigail are full-time students. Clint's expenses during the 2019 fall semester are as follows: $3,400 tuition, $350 books and course materials, and $1,600 room and board. Abigail's expenses for the 2019 calendar year are as follows: $10,200 tuition, $1,200 books and course materials, and $3,600 room and board. Tuition and the applicable room and board costs are paid at the beginning of each semester. Bradley spends $3,000 in 2019 to attend continuing education seminars in engineering to remain current in his field. Bradley is married, files a joint tax return, claims both children as dependents, and has a combined AGI with his wife of $111,000 for 2019. A. Determine Bradley's available education tax credit for 2019. B. Explain the purpose of these credits
